The British Council has had a presence in Nepal since 1959. The British Council office in Nepal has been active in improving the teaching and learning of English, education sector projects and partnership programs, education promotion, UK examination and policy dialogue activities. British Council has also delivered range of Skills programmes in South Asia.

Exams Officer:  Computer-Based Tests, Nepal Examinations Services, Number of positions to be filled: 1

Vacancy Description

Contract: Indefinite, Band H | Region: South Asia | Country: Nepal | Location: Kathmandu | Department: English & Exams| 

The post holder will conduct computer based/computer delivered test in country and provide 1st level IT system and network troubleshooting as required. This role is broader than managing exam papers and includes managing logistics and ensuring timely scanning and submitting of exam papers to meet requirements for marking. This role also includes managing strategic relationship with vendor and partners (e.g. Courier) in the distribution chain.  This role will suit IT experts who want to build a career in the fast-growing sector of international examinations.

Main Opportunities / Challenges for the role

  • Provide 1st level troubleshooting and technical support to deliver computer-based/computer-delivered tests. Support IT Manager by ensuring test delivery computers and devices are compliant, working and optimally used.
  • Optimal use of technology to maximise efficiency in daily operations, overcoming old practices through innovation where necessary.
  • Drive right behaviours in the team towards greater awareness related to maintaining confidentiality of sensitive exam related materials                  
  • Implement improvement actions in the distribution and logistics of handling confidential materials.

CMR & Logistics Officer: Nepal Examinations Services Number of positions to be filled: 1

Vacancy Description

Contract: Indefinite, Band H | Region: South Asia | Country: Nepal | Location: Kathmandu | Department: English & Exams

The purpose of this role is to ensure the integrity of the end to end handling and movement of confidential materials in and out of the Confidential Materials Room (CMR). This includes managing strategic relationship with vendor and partners (e.g. Couriers) in the distribution chain. The role is also required to ensure compliance to set standards on CMR set up and access. 

Main Opportunities / Challenges for the role

  • Drive right behaviors in the team towards greater awareness related to maintaining the confidentiality of sensitive exam related materials                  
  • Implement improvement actions in the distribution and logistics of handling confidential materials
